Answer for How to use a dehumidifier

Once you have purchased your dehumidifier, check to see that everything specified by the manufacturer is present. Refer to the user manual to know how to set up your dehumidifier. Ensure the buckets are firmly fixed and the built-in pump (if any) is properly fixed as indicated on the manual. When you turn on your dehumidifier for the first time, set the RH percentage to the driest level possible—Most dehumidifiers have RH settings as low as 30% and as high as 90%. After a couple of cycles, you can set the RH to a desired percentage—most people will keep it at 50%. The automatic humidistat will keep the percentage where you prefer it. Ensure your unit is properly maintained by regularly cleaning the filter, if your unit has a bucket, ensure it’s emptied at the right time.
